INTERVIEW WITH JOCHEN SCHAEPERS,
HEAD OF THE DESIGN DEPARTMENT

TOGETHER WE CREATE CREATIVE PRODUCTS

YOU HAVE NOW BEEN WORKING AT KUHN RIKON FOR A YEAR. HOW HAVE YOU SETTLED IN?

A lot of things were new to me. I had only just moved to Switzerland a short time before. Prior to that, I had lived in New York for nearly 25 years and worked exclusively for design consultancy firms. To head up a design team at such a renowned manufacturer as Kuhn Rikon was a great challenge for me. I was naturally very nervous at the start. What are the people actually like in this foreign country, and will I be able to understand them at all? (I am German by birth.) And then there was also the fact that the Coronavirus hit us just as I was starting, with all the ensuing restrictions.

But despite everything, before I knew it, I was just simply part of this large family called Kuhn Rikon. The reciprocal support, the openness, the close collaboration are just brilliant. It doesn’t matter who I am dealing with – I can just be myself and that is very important to me. The other thing that surprised me is the receptiveness and flexibility in trying out suggestions for new ways of working and implementing them. Already, after such a short time, I have the feeling that my contributions do make a small difference. What more can you want?

So, I have settled in very well; only, as regards Swiss German … oh dear!

WHICH PROJECTS HAVE YOU BEEN LOOKING AFTER THIS YEAR?

Apart from the project business for which we are developing numerous kitchen gadgets, and which makes up a great deal of our work, we have the opportunity to rework our most important product lines, the DUROMATIC und the DUROTHERM. We are also developing another cookware line for our «hobby chef» target group with a totally new aesthetic. We are in the middle of all this and I am super excited as to how it will all turn out.

Also, at the same time, we are working on re-defining our design strategy and doing so more precisely so that the quality of our products is conveyed more clearly. I find it very exciting to tackle the projects under one roof together with all the other teams – Product Management, Development and Marketing right through to Sales.

YOU HELPED WITH THE DESIGN OF THE NEW LIMITED EDITION OF THE COLORI®+ PARING KNIVES. HOW DID YOU HIT UPON THE DESIGN? CAN YOU EXPLAIN TO US HOW SUCH LIMITED EDITIONS COME ABOUT?
That is such a good example as to why I am glad to have a versatile team as, to be quite honest, I am less interested in this purely decorative task. What you can’t see here is all the many, many other attempts at a pattern that did not make it. At the outset we immersed ourselves in trends in all possible areas – furniture, textiles, interior design, fashion, product, etc. – before we started to brainstorm different ideas and then sketch samples. The difficult thing is then to choose from all these attempts. I actually think the final phase is the most important one when the motifs are created in detail because, ultimately, you put your heart and soul into producing these, it doesn’t matter what the subject is. And this should be apparent.

WHICH KUHN RIKON PRODUCTS DO YOU LIKE BEST FROM A DESIGN POINT OF VIEW?
That is very easy to answer. No other product of ours touches our classic, the DUROMATIC Inox. Its beauty lies in its unpretentious, but pleasing, simplicity. Competitors' products are mostly too fussy. Above all, however, when it’s a question of safety, less complexity is always better. As a designer, I understand only too well that it is not that easy to make something simple. The handles too reflect this with their simple, elegant shape. And the conical lid is just simply iconic; that is Kuhn Rikon.
